  10. Honestly, I have to say that I totally forgot about this feature in Cakewalk until I was going through my preferences. Check it out, newbies you might be in for a surprise. To turn on this feature, go to preferences. Look under Customization and click on Display, and then click on "Enable X-Ray" near the bottom of the window. Now open a plugin, or a virtual instrument and click on it and then hold down Shift and X. This works on most Plugins and Virtual instruments.

Unless you're planning to play parts of the project live (eg: you have a MIDI keyboard playing VSTi synths, or you're running a guitar through an amp sim, etc.) then save yourself the headache and mix your backing tracks down to MP3 or WAV rather than playing it live in a DAW. With an i3, you don't have a lot of headroom for things to screw up, so a simple glitch might be enough to pause the audio engine and ruin your show. Now, this isn't to say Cakewalk can't be used as a live performance tool - it can and is being used for that by lots of people - but if you don't need the bells and whistles of a full DAW, I'd really recommend erring on the safe side and going as simple as possible.
